Ultimate + Apocalypse Battles
Imperial Shadow ++
凶Imperial Shadow
HP: 337,500
Target Score:
- Defeat the Imperial Shadow with at least 3 characters not KO'ed.
Weak: None
Absorbs: None
Resists: None
Null: Ice, Poison
Vulnerabilities: None
Notes: You have magical piercing and regular physical hits to worry about here. Wall or Protect is enough to handle the physical threats, so focus on debuffing magic.
Imperial Shadow prefers lightning element damage, as well as Sap and Instant KO. The plus side of his ~25% accuracy instant death ability is that it can be Runic'ed. Break out those Celes SSB RW's.
If you're bringing said Runic, you can focus on lightning resist accessories. It is also an option to bring a Raise spell and focus on the accessory mitigation because the piercing magic attacks are AoE and he uses them regularly.
Acolyte Archive: Luckily this is a straightforward fight. 2x DD, support, healer, and whatever else you want should suffice just fine.
Remember that Firion carries an ancient as hell instant party Magic Blink is his BSB.
King Behemoth (Apoc +)
滅King Behemoth
HP: 500,000
Target Score:
- Defeat King Behemoth with 2 or more heroes not KO'ed.
Weak: None
Absorbs: None
Resist: None
Null: None
Vulnerabilities: None
Notes: Entirely a physical fight. You can also ignore the Haste, but do have to content with Stun.
A very boring physical only fight. Tank and spank is really the only way to approach this. You can carry Stun resist if you want at the cost of that 30-45 atk. It shouldn't matter much.
Green Dragons (Apoc ++)
滅Green Dragon x2
HP: 300,000 each
Target Score:
- Defeat both bosses with 2 or more heroes not KO'ed.
Weak: Ice
Absorbs: None
Resist: None
Null: Poison
Vulnerabilities: None
Notes: Mixed damage from both dragons, but it is the magic stuff you'll want to focus on. With 2 targets that piercing magic damage can add up quick. Element resist of choice is poison.
Additionally, aside from the ST Stun potential, being afflicted with Poison will cause you to lose 2.5x as much HP as usual - so Ultra cure may be better overall than Curada.
No special kill mechanics either, though the dragons will use more dangerous attacks as their HP goes down. Focus fire them out one at a time to make it easier.
Acolyte Archive:
Could potentially be a difficult fight as FFII synergy isn't exactly abundant. You'll definitely want a medica of some sort to deal with the AoE attacks. On top of that, Scott and Maria can both help Firion with ice element damage - just not from a perspective of it being their preferred element.
Like the previous CM, don't neglect some SSB's you may have in your vault collecting dust from this realm. HotE is still a good physical buff, Firion has a great BSB entry effect, and even Maria can get a 20% magic boost from her old SSB if you're running a mixed party.
